Your new company is a well‑established organisation operating not far from the M4. They have been active for many years and continue to invest heavily in strengthening their financial controls, data accuracy, and reporting transparency. As part of this, they are seeking additional analytical support within their central finance function.

Your new role involves analysing large and complex datasets to identify mismatches or anomalies, investigating and reconciling items by working with teams across Finance and Engineering as well as other departments. You will be developing and maintaining reconciliation models, dashboards and reporting tools. You will also deliver clear and concise explanations on findings to finance leaders and other stakeholders.

What you'll need to succeed:

  • Experience in the above duties
  • Advanced Excel skills with experience in SQL, PowerBI, etc.
  • An analytical mind and competence in stakeholder management

How to prepare for a job interview at Hays Accounts and Finance

Know Your Numbers

Make sure you brush up on your financial analysis skills. Be prepared to discuss your experience with large datasets and how you've identified anomalies in the past. Having specific examples ready will show that you can handle the analytical demands of the role.

Excel-lent Preparation

Since advanced Excel skills are a must, practice using functions and tools that are relevant to the job. Familiarise yourself with SQL and PowerBI as well, so you can confidently discuss how you've used these tools to create dashboards or reporting models in previous roles.

Stakeholder Savvy

This role involves working with various teams, so be ready to talk about your experience in stakeholder management. Think of examples where you've effectively communicated findings or collaborated with others to resolve issues. This will demonstrate your ability to work in a collaborative environment.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's financial controls and reporting processes.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you understand how you can contribute to meaningful improvements in data quality and transparency.
